Event Overview
Back for another year, the Horsham Jobs and Skills Fair will transform the Drill Hall into a bustling marketplace of opportunity. Organised by Horsham District Council, the fair aims to “bridge the gap between local talent and local business”, according to organisers.
Attendees can speak face-to-face with employers, discover training pathways, and even secure on-the-spot interviews. It’s a one-stop shop for anyone eager to ignite or reboot a career in Horsham’s vibrant economy.

What to Expect
Local Employers
Up to 40 businesses — from innovative tech start-ups to household-name retailers — will showcase live vacancies. Bring copies of your CV: some employers conduct impromptu interviews.
Training & Apprenticeships
Local colleges and training providers will be on hand to explain apprenticeship schemes, part-time study options, and funding routes. Whether you’re reskilling or upskilling, expert guidance awaits.
Interactive Workshops
- Crafting a standout CV in today’s competitive market.
- Mastering the STAR interview technique.
- Networking with confidence — even if you’re shy.
Logistics & Accessibility
Venue: The Drill Hall, Denne Road, Horsham, RH12 1JF.
Transport: Five-minute walk from Horsham railway station; multiple bus routes stop nearby.
Step-free access, accessible toilets, and quiet zones ensure an inclusive experience. Entry is free for job-seekers, though pre-registration is advised to avoid queues.
How to Make the Most of the Fair
- Research attending employers in advance and prepare questions.
- Dress smart-casual; first impressions count.
- Bring multiple CV copies and a pen for quick notes.
- Attend a workshop early — seats fill fast.
- Follow up with contacts within 48 hours.
